Bollore to extend Europe-Africa cargo flights

Bollore Logistics operates WARA air service for airbridge Europe West Africa

Bollore Logistics is extending its special weekly cargo charter freight service between Europe and West Africa, the Wara Air Service, until the end of the month.

Over the last three months Bollore Logistics has operated two or three weekly all-cargo flights between Liege and Roissy Charles-de-Gaulle to Abidjan, Bamako, Accra, Freetown, Ouagadougou, Conakry, Niamey, Monrovia and Nouakchott.

The logistics firm said it originally launched the flights in response to capacity reductions linked to the coronavirus outbreak.

Since the introduction of transport restrictions, some 30 flights have already ensured the shipment of 1,800 tonnes of goods intended for humanitarian aid, health materials and equipment, medical and food products, spare parts, telecoms equipment and other daily consumer goods.

For example, over 100 tonnes of mangoes have been exported from Africa to Europe.

The logistics firm said it would also consider extending the services beyond July 31.
